The Bank of Iwate, Ltd. engages in the provision of various financial products and services in Japan. It operates through three segments: Commercial Banking Business; Leasing Business; and Credit Card and Credit Guarantee Business. The Commercial Banking Business segment provides current and time deposits, as well as negotiable certificates of deposit; personal and SME loans; and securities investment and foreign exchange services. The Leasing Business segment consists of financial leasing, and computer processing contract business. The Credit Card and Credit Guarantee Business segment comprises credit card and guarantee business. It also trades in securities, as well as offers investment fund management, consulting, and regional economic survey services. The company was formerly known as Iwate Shokusan Bank and changed its name to The Bank of Iwate, Ltd. in 1960. The Bank of Iwate, Ltd. was incorporated in 1932 and is headquartered in Morioka, Japan.
